Injuries Chiropractors Can Help Treat

Chiropractors treat your musculoskeletal system, aligning your spine and other bones. Seeing a chiropractor after a car accident can help with many injuries, including:

  • Whiplash or neck pain
  • Tension headaches
  • Lower back pain
  • Muscle sprains and strains
  • Sciatica and nerve pain

If you’re experiencing pain after an accident, you should see a chiropractor. Although some aches and pains will disappear after a few days or weeks, you may notice some injuries lasting much longer. Chiropractic adjustments are a highly effective treatment for short-term and chronic pain.

1. Noninvasive Approach to Healing

Chiropractic care is a noninvasive and drug-free treatment option for car accident injuries. This can be particularly appealing to individuals who prefer to avoid surgery or excessive use of pain medications. Chiropractors use manual techniques and other therapies to promote healing and restore function, without the need for invasive procedures. 

2. Nerve and Soft Tissue Pain Relief

Car accidents can cause misalignments in the spine, known as subluxations, which can lead to pain and restricted movement. Chiropractors evaluate and adjust the spine to restore proper alignment. By realigning the spine, chiropractic care can help relieve pressure on nerves, reduce pain and promote natural healing.

You may also experience soft tissue injuries such as sprains, strains and whiplash after a car accident. Chiropractors are trained to assess and treat these injuries. They can use various techniques such as massage, stretching and joint mobilization to reduce inflammation, improve range of motion and promote healing in the affected tissues.
